                      Don’t think we’ll make many changes based on that and Bramble was okay, Cleary started poorly but actually turned it around and had a decent impact in the end and same as McNeil.

                      So based on last night those 3 were fine after some early errors - BUT they’re very clearly the 3 weak links in this side and they’re going to be fine against shit teams that let you run around and do what you want but I just feel all 3 of them absolutely go to water against decent sides.

                      I get not everyone can be a star and you need role players but I don’t think these 3 are solid enough in high pressure games to keep persisting with. Bramble is not particularly good at anything, pretty poor defensively, runs fast but usually aimlessly and turnover merchant. Cleary actually can defend which is nice but his body is still no where near it, not particularly strong overhead and whilst he should be a good kick he also can’t be trusted.

                      McNeil does so much right so it’s frustrating, works super hard, competes & pressures but he kills us offensively, one of the worst finishers in the comp which is one thing but it’s also the way he continuously breaks down offensive chains - every single time he gets the ball on the wing he takes 15 seconds too scared to make a decision before finally throwing it on the boot to a contest, if not straight turning it over.

                      We clearly don’t have many other options in these positions but I think it’s time to try something to find a better balance whilst we have some easier games.

                      Garcias not exactly the cleanest user either although I think he’s better than McNeil, or at the very least more decisive. Hes not exactly what we’re screaming for in a small forward but I’d be tempted to throw him in and just go full 2016 style chaos ball inside 50 - Darcy & Naughty the marking targets with a mix of West, Garcia, Harmes, Kennedy etc at ground level. Not really a hell of a lot of class there but the opposition is going to have a bad time when the ball hits the ground and we know the midfield will give them enough supply to just cause carnage at ground level

                      The Backlines a tough one with only really JJ to return. I think having Freijah & Williams spend more time there has been important - we just needed some composure and they both provide it. I like the two tall set up best but I tend to agree with above that Buss is hybrid enough to play Clearys role and we don’t really lose anything. I’d be tempted to try this for a few weeks and see how it goes. I don’t want another Jones or Gardner type though, unless match ups permit it.

                      I don’t think Jacques is ready and backline is a bit harder than forward to come in underdone because your mistakes can really pay. But in saying that I think he’s deserves a shot considering the potential reward is big. And realistically the one that can really make a difference here in the short term is Selwood if he can pick up the speed quick, he’d be perfect to cover Clearys role.

                      So long story short, I think we need to try and plug the 3 weakest links in our team and we do have some options for it over the coming weeks - any mix of Buss, Sellwood, Jacques, JJ, Harmes, Garcia in for Bramble, Cleary, McNeil.

                      McNeil can be super sub, he’s actually pretty decent at that role seems to play better late. Hynes id prefer to play full games at VFL level, and Dolan I think has shown enough to warrant a starting 22 spot - really like him a lot
